Patriots Hire Michael Lombardi

Sep 19, 2014 8:21 PM

The New England Patriots have announced the hiring of Michael Lombardi as an assistant to the coaching staff.

Lombardi was recently let go as general manager of the Cleveland Browns.

Lombardi worked with Bill Belichick during the 1990s with the Browns.

MIchael Lombardi With Patriots At NFL Combine

Oct 30, 2014 11:20 AM

Michael Lombardi was part of the New England Patriots' traveling contingent on Wednesday to the NFL combine.

Lombardi's relationship with Bill Belichick goes back to the early 1990s when both were with the Cleveland Browns.

Lombardi was relieved of his duties as general manager of the Browns this month and had been in talks about joining the Patriots.

Emmanuel Sanders Unlikely To Re-Sign With Steelers

Oct 9, 2014 2:19 PM

Emmanuel Sanders is note expected to return to the Pittsburgh Steelers this offseason.

Sanders has begun preparations for the open market, parting ways with agent Jordan Woy.

Sanders is already on the radar of the New York Jets, while the New England Patriots could also be interested.

The Steelers have indicated that they plan on drafting a big wide receiver in May.

Patriots Could Select Mid-Round QB To Maintain Salary Flexibility

May 18, 2014 7:50 AM

The New England Patriots have spent cheaply for backup quarterbacks over the past six seasons.

The average backup quarterback makes approximately $3.5 million to $4 million per season, but the Patriots have spent as little as $310,000 and no more than $776,976.

The Patriots moved away from Brian Hoyer in 2012 when he had a restricted free agent tender of $1.9 million and could do the same in 2015 when Ryan Mallett begins making a salary on par for a backup.

The Patriots could select a developmental quarterback in the middle to late rounds of the 2014 NFL Draft to begin the process of replacing Mallett.
